Solely 6% of motorists within the UK are in a position to accurately establish a tyre’s load ranking, in line with a survey commissioned by Apollo Tyres.

The load ranking signifies the utmost weight of the automobile that may safely use the tyre, so selecting a tyre with an unsuitable load ranking can compromise the automobile’s efficiency and effectivity, in addition to its security.

Fashionable electrical autos (EVs) are sometimes a lot heavier than standard combustion engine options, making it much more vital for shoppers to pick a appropriate tyre.

The ballot of 1,000 motorists additionally discovered that 11% of males have been in a position to establish the load ranking mark on a tyre, in comparison with simply 3% of girls.

Moreover, simply 14% of motorists are conscious that tyres fitted to an EV usually must be inflated to larger pressures, to make sure secure and environment friendly operation.

That proportion falls to solely 6% amongst motorists aged 55 to 64, and peaks at over half (52%) amongst 18 to 24-year-olds. Crucially, amongst EV drivers, the share continues to be low – simply 38%.

Tyre inflation charges are particular to every automobile and are important for sustaining optimum ranges of grip, traction and rolling resistance.

“As Europe strikes in direction of the mass adoption of EVs, it’s changing into much more vital for carmakers and the broader tyre trade – from producers to retailers and fitters – to assist shoppers perceive the essential significance of load ranking compatibility and the necessity to keep appropriate inflation charges,” stated Yves Pouliquen of Apollo Tyres.

“The necessity to educate extends past the purpose of buy. EV house owners understandably wish to maximise driving vary, however under-inflation can considerably improve rolling resistance and that equates to poor effectivity.”
